Erts 9.1.4 + +
Fixed Bugs and Malfunctions + + +

Microstate accounting sometimes produced incorrect + results for dirty schedulers.

+

+ Own Id: OTP-14707

+
+ +

Fixed a regression in zlib:gunzip/1 that + prevented it from working when the decompressed size was + a perfect multiple of 16384. This regression was + introduced in 20.1.1

+

+ Own Id: OTP-14730 Aux Id: ERL-507

+
+ +

Fixed a memory corruption bug in + enif_inspect_iovec; writable binaries stayed + writable after entering the iovec.

+

+ Own Id: OTP-14745

+
+ +

Fixed a crash in enif_inspect_iovec on + encountering empty binaries.

+

+ Own Id: OTP-14750

+
+ +

zlib:deflateParams/3 will no longer return + buf_error when called after zlib:deflate/2 + with zlib 1.2.11.

+

+ Own Id: OTP-14751

+
